Facts
Plaintiff Garen Wimer was involved in a car accident with another motorist who worked for defendant United States of America. Wimer filed suit for motor vehicle negligence on September 12, 2007.
Contentions
PLAINTIFF'S CONTENTIONS:
Wimer contended that the defendant's employee was negligent in the operation of his motor vehicle while in the course and scope of his employment with defendant United States, and caused Wimer's injuries.
DEFENDANT'S CONTENTIONS:
The defendant denied all allegations.
Result
Wimer accepted a settlement in the amount of $35,000.
